Badger Basket Hooded Moses BasketMoses baskets help to create space for baby anywhere in the home. They're the most versatile baby carriers on the market and they also double as a great sleep area. The Badger Basket Hooded Moses Basket provides a safe place for baby to sleep while at home or visiting other family and friends. Moses baskets provide the parent with a great way to bond with child as the basket ensures the child will always be close by. The Badger Basket Hooded Moses Basket features a soft bumper/liner and foam mattress pad. The basket is 6 inches deep in the middle to support the back and torso while the head is a little deeper to keep it stable in case of any unforeseen circumstance occurs. The Moses Basket features a removable hood which attaches easily with Velcro.

this basket is really cute and was very useful for the 1st 3 months or so to have a safe place to put baby in different rooms of the house. We live in a 2 story home with finished basement so this basket was really helpful to bring baby with me to diffrent rooms without having to put him on the floor or lug around a pack and play or cradle. Also was convenient for a co-sleeping option. baby can be in the basket on the bed with you and you need not worry about rolling on him....but if you are a deep or restless sleeper don't try it...they basket is not THAT sturdy and could get pushed off the bed. everything in the kit is removeable and the fabric can be washed.

2 reasons it didnt get 5 out of 5 stars for me. the fabric liner is not sewn in very well to ribbons that attach it to basket. Just a few more stitches in each would have sufficed and then the liner would have stayed in perfectly. I ended up with a really floppy liner in places. Yes you can reinforce these with a needle and thread....but realistically....the item should come in a state that the buyer doesn't have to do that. Plus what new mom has time and free hands to do this? If you buy this... reinforce the ribbons from the start with an extra stitch at each and you will be fine.

Also the ad doesn't state this, but despite the handles, they do not recommend that you carry baby from room to room using the basket. I used one hand to hold the handles and one to support the basket from the bottom if I had sleeping baby in the basket or carried him separate from basket when changing rooms.

Still this was an awesome basket and at a decent price. We got lots of complements on it.

Here are the pros and cons of this basket -

Pros:
- Light and easy to carry up and down the stairs.
- It takes up very little room, I set it on a cedar chest next to the bed.
- I didn't have a problem when I washed the liner and sheet in the machine. Maybe using a delicate/handwash cycle would help.
- The sheets we used in a regular bassinet fit in this just fine.
- The pad is quite thick.

Cons:
- The handles are twisted. I think this was due to the way it was packaged for shipping. It does not affect the usability.
- The ribbon that holds the liner in place has come off several times, including in the wash. It does not appear to be attached with much thread. I just reattached them with more/thicker thread.
- The liner around the head of the basket sags into the basket and gets in my daughter's face. Adding two ribbons at the top to attach it to the basket would fix this.
